Why Balers Need Speed Increase, Not Reduction

Unlike tillage gearboxes that slow the PTO output for soil-working implements, versnellingsbak voor ronde balenpers assemblies must increase rotor speed dramatically. Baler pickup reels, wrapping mechanisms, and net-binding systems operate most efficiently at speeds far above the 540 rpm PTO standard. The EP-1800B’s 0.4375 : 1 ratio boosts PTO speed by 2.29×, delivering 1,234 rpm to the baler’s main drive shaft — the speed that Korean and Asian round balers are designed to operate at for consistent bale density and clean straw pickup.

Integrated 900 mm Tube Output

The EP-1800B features a 900 mm steel tube that houses the output shaft and extends from the gearbox body to the baler’s main rotor input. This tube serves dual purposes: it transmits rotational power at 1,234 rpm through the internal shaft, and it acts as a structural backbone that ties the gearbox housing to the baler frame. By integrating the output shaft and structural tube into a single assembly, the EP-1800B eliminates the separate intermediate shaft, support bearings, and universal joints that older baler driveline designs required.

Baler Speed-Increase Engineering — Why 1,234 RPM

Round balers and straw return machines use multiple high-speed rotating components that must operate well above PTO speed for proper function. Understanding why each subsystem needs 1,200+ rpm output explains the engineering rationale behind the EP-1800B’s 0.4375 : 1 ratio:

Pickup Reel

The tine-bar pickup reel must sweep straw from the ground surface at a tip speed that exceeds the tractor’s ground speed. At 1,234 rpm through the baler’s internal reduction, the pickup achieves the 2.5–3.0 m/s tine speed needed for clean, aggressive straw gathering without leaving windrow remnants.

Bale Chamber Rollers

Round baler chamber rollers must rotate fast enough to continuously feed and compress incoming straw against the forming bale core. The 1,234 rpm gearbox output, distributed through the baler’s internal chain drive, achieves the roller surface speed required for consistent bale density across the full chamber width.

Net Wrap / Twine System

Net wrapping and twine binding systems require precise, high-speed rotation to dispense material evenly around the completed bale. Insufficient speed causes uneven coverage and loose bales that break apart during transport — the 1,234 rpm source provides the consistent drive these mechanisms demand.

900 mm Tube Output — Structural Integration with the Baler Frame

Baler gearbox tube output engineering — 900mm integrated shaft tube, high-RPM bearing support

Dual-Function Tube Design

The EP-1800B’s 900 mm output tube is not simply a protective cover for the internal shaft — it serves as a load-bearing structural member that ties the gearbox housing to the baler’s main frame. The tube’s 160 × 76 mm cross-section provides the bending stiffness needed to resist the vertical loads generated during baler operation: the weight of the bale chamber, the dynamic forces of straw feeding, and the transport loads during field-to-farm travel over rough terrain.

High-RPM Shaft Engineering

The internal output shaft rotates at 1,234 rpm inside the tube — more than double the speed of tillage gearbox outputs. At this speed, shaft dynamics become critical: any imbalance, misalignment, or bearing degradation produces vibration that accelerates wear throughout the entire baler driveline. Korea Ever-Power precision-balances the output shaft assembly and uses high-speed-rated bearings with tighter radial clearance specifications than standard agricultural bearings. The shaft runs on support bearings at both the gearbox end and the output flange end of the tube, maintaining concentricity over the full 900 mm span.

Output Flange & Keyed Shaft Connection

The distal end of the tube terminates in a combined flange-and-shaft output: a Ø220 mm flange (4-Ø13 bolts on Ø190 PCD) provides rigid frame mounting, while the Ø50 mm keyed shaft (14 × 70 mm keyway) transmits rotational power to the baler’s internal drive mechanism. This combined interface allows the baler frame to be structurally connected to the gearbox tube while independently accepting rotational drive — separating structural loads from drivetrain torque for cleaner force paths and longer component life.

Baler Driveline Integration — Where the EP-1800B Fits

PTO drive shaft connecting tractor to baler speed increaser gearbox

Power Path: Tractor to Bale

In a typical Korean round baler installation, the power path runs: tractor PTO (540 rpm) → PTO drive shaft → EP-1800B input spline → spiral bevel gear set (0.4375 : 1 speed increase) → 900 mm tube output shaft (1,234 rpm) → output flange/keyed shaft → baler internal chain drive → pickup reel, chamber rollers, and binding mechanism. The EP-1800B occupies the critical speed-conversion position in this chain, and its reliability directly determines the baler’s uptime during the narrow straw-season harvest window.

Structural Integration

The EP-1800B’s gearbox housing mounts to the baler’s front crossmember, and the 900 mm tube extends rearward to the baler’s main structural beam. This arrangement creates a rigid triangulated connection between the PTO attachment point and the baler frame, reducing frame flex during operation and transport. For baler OEMs designing new machines, the EP-1800B simplifies the frame layout by eliminating separate gearbox mounting brackets and intermediate bearing supports.

Installatie en onderhoud

Round baler in field operation — straw pickup, baling, and wrapping process

Montageprocedure

❶ Mount the EP-1800B gearbox housing to the baler’s front crossmember. Ensure the tube is supported by the baler frame’s guide brackets at intervals not exceeding 300 mm along its 900 mm length.

❷ Connect the output flange (4-Ø13 on Ø190) and keyed shaft (Ø50, 14×70 keyway) to the baler’s internal drive input. Torque flange bolts to specification.

❸ Connect the PTO drive shaft to the 8×42×48×8 input spline. Verify full engagement and install the safety guard.

❹ Fill gear oil (SAE 80W-90 GL-5) through the top breather valve. Run a 5-minute idle test, then verify at full 540 rpm — confirming smooth 1,234 rpm output rotation, zero leaks, and no abnormal noise.

Onderhoudsschema

Voor elke balenperssessie — Check oil level; inspect output shaft keyway and flange bolts; verify tube support brackets are secure.

Na de eerste 100 uur — Eerste olieverversing: aftappen, doorspoelen en bijvullen met verse SAE 80W-90 GL-5.

Elke 400 uur — Oil change (shorter interval than reducer gearboxes due to high-RPM thermal load).

Elke 800 uur — Inspect output shaft bearing play; check keyway for deformation; examine input spline condition.

Einde van het stroseizoen — Top off gear oil, apply corrosion inhibitor to exposed shaft surfaces, and store the baler with the PTO disconnected.

Why does the EP-1800B need more frequent oil changes than tillage gearboxes?
The EP-1800B operates at 1,234 rpm output — approximately 3.5× faster than typical tillage gearbox outputs (324–352 rpm). This higher speed generates more friction heat and accelerates oil oxidation. Korea Ever-Power specifies a 400-hour oil change interval instead of the 500-hour interval used for reducer gearboxes.
